How big is the water & wastewater utilities market in Michigan?
The statewide water & wastewater utilities total addressable market in Michigan is $483M, aggregated across 32 MSAs. This represents 2.6% of the $18.8B U.S. water & wastewater utilities market.
How does Michigan rank nationally for water & wastewater utilities?
Michigan ranks #13 of 51 states by water & wastewater utilities TAM — the 76th percentile. The ranking is based on aggregate MSA-level TAM within each state's geographic boundaries.

What drives water & wastewater utilities attractiveness in Michigan's metros?
PinpointIQ's Water & Wastewater Utilities Market Score for every MSA in Michigan is computed from 3 components: Total Households (40%); Fragmentation Score (35%); Total Pop Growth (5-Year) (25%). Each component is scored at the national percentile level before being weighted into the composite.
